Frequently Asked Questions about Webber-Camden

What type of rentals are currently available in Webber-Camden?

There are currently 241 Apartments for Rent in Webber-Camden, MN with pricing that ranges from $900 to $3,395. There are also 53 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Webber-Camden ranging from $1,149 to $3,995.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Webber-Camden?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Webber-Camden ranges from $1,149 to $3,995 with an average monthly rent of $2,294.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Webber-Camden?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Webber-Camden range from $1,500 to $2,760,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,550 to $3,995.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,660 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,314.
